Chip Shot: New Intel Server Adapters Keep Network Traffic Flowing

Font size:

Intel has launched a set of SFP+ pluggable 10 Gigabit Ethernet server adapters that allow customers to mix and match Intel® Ethernet SFP+ optic modules for various network distances. The new Intel® Ethernet X520 Server Adapters feature advanced technologies that help reduce network I/O bottlenecks in virtualized servers. These new dual- and single-port server adapters also simplify network infrastructure and reduce hardware needs by allowing both LAN and storage traffic to travel over Ethernet.
